How do social rights impact political formation? 🔊
Social rights impact political formation by shaping social equity, justice, and the relationship between citizens and the state. These rights, which encompass issues such as education, healthcare, and housing, contribute to the development of welfare policies and social programs. When recognized and upheld, social rights foster inclusive governance and reduce political disenfranchisement. Consequently, they play a crucial role in shaping civic identity, influencing political activism, and facilitating the overall democratic process.
